Along with this, Microsoft announced that it is opening its Windows Hello Companion device framework for the third party. The company, while presenting the framework, described how it unlocks from wearable to PC and also gave a demo with a nymest band. Windows Hello already supports the facial ricganization and fingerprint sensor. The company is also working on the new version of its authenticator app, so that other Windows 10 devices will also be unlocked through Windows 10 mobiles.
Microsoft also announced the opening of its mixed reality holographic platform for VR headset manufacturers. Windows also released a video containing detailed information about Hallographic’s capabilities. This OS can be used only by VR headset manufacturers.
